Types of Floor Mat Tears

Car floor mat tears come in various forms. Recognizing the type of tear will help you select the right repair method:

  • Small tears: These are minor rips or punctures that can usually be repaired with glue and patches.
  • Large tears: These are more extensive rips that may require sewing or a floor mat repair kit.
  • Fraying edges: Frayed edges can occur on the edges of the mat and can be easily repaired with glue or sewing.

Quick and Easy Floor Mat Repair Solutions

Here are some quick and easy solutions for repairing your torn car floor mat:

Option 1: Fabric Glue and Patches

This method is suitable for small tears and frayed edges.

  • selecting the right glue: select a strong, flexible fabric glue that’s designed for use on materials like nylon or rubber.
  • Choosing appropriate patches: Use patches made of similar material to your floor mat. For a seamless look, you can cut patches from an old floor mat.
  • Applying glue and patches: Apply a thin layer of glue to both the torn area and the patch. Press the patch firmly onto the tear and hold it in place for a few seconds.
  • Letting the glue dry: Allow the glue to dry completely before using the floor mat. This may take several hours, depending on the type of glue used.

Option 2: Sewing the Tear

Sewing is a more durable option for larger tears and frayed edges.

  • Choosing thread and needle: select a strong, heavy-duty thread and a sturdy needle that can easily pierce through the mat material.
  • Sewing the torn edges: Carefully sew the torn edges together using a strong, even stitch.
  • Securing the stitches: Tie a secure knot at the end of the stitching to prevent unraveling.

Advanced Floor Mat Repair Options

For more extensive damage, consider these advanced repair options:

Option 3: Using a Floor Mat Repair Kit

Floor mat repair kits are available at most auto parts stores.

  • Components of a repair kit: Repair kits usually contain a special adhesive, patching material, and instructions.
  • Following instructions: Carefully follow the instructions offerd with the kit for optimal outcomes.

Option 4: Professional Repair

If the damage is severe or you’re unsure how to repair the floor mat yourself, consider seeking professional help.

  • Finding a specialist: Look for a local upholstery shop or auto interior repair specialist.
  • Cost and time: The cost of professional repair will vary depending on the extent of the damage. Allow several days for the repair to be completed.

Preventing Future Floor Mat Tears

Here are some tips to prevent future floor mat tears:

  • Maintaining Your Floor Mats: Regularly clean your floor mats to remove dirt, debris, and spills that can weaken the material.
  • Avoiding sharp objects: Be careful not to place sharp objects on your floor mats. This includes things like keys, knives, and tools.
